Abstract

A load transfer system includes a load transfer bushing having a first and second arcuate segments configured to engage a load surface of a tubular or of a collar connected to the tubular, and an elevator configured to receive the load transfer bushing. Moving the elevator from its closed position to its open position while the elevator engages the load transfer bushing moves the first and second arcuate segments apart, permitting the elevator and the load transfer bushing to be received around the tubular. Moving the elevator from the opened position to the closed position with the load transfer bushing and elevator surrounding the tubular forms an axial engagement load surface for the load surface of the tubular or the collar. The load transfer bushing is disengageable from the elevator.
